Certification scope

What the certificate covers.

The Information Security Management System applies to the software design and development, operation, maintenance and support of Navionyx SaaS based EV telematics, GPS tracking, fleet management and IoT software solutions, including web applications, mobile applications, APIs, cloud infrastructure, databases, third party technology integrations and customer support services.

Scope wording reproduced exactly as printed on the certificate. Certification applies to the management system. Individual products, GPS devices and customer deployments are not automatically certified.

How we maintain it

Certification is a practice, not a document.

The certificate stays valid only while the management system keeps running. These are the controls we operate continuously between audits.

Internal audits and management reviews

Scheduled reviews of controls, findings, and corrective actions.

Risk register and supplier evaluation

Ongoing assessment of information security risk and third-party technology partners.

Incident records and security testing

Documented incident handling with recorded testing across platform and infrastructure.

Employee awareness and access control

Training records and role-based access across systems handling customer data.
